The Marina de València manages the marina and the moorings of the city's historic dock. Its location on the Mediterranean coast has made it a chosen destination point for boats from all over Europe. Created for the realization of the America’s Cup, an event that allowed the recovery of the maritime space for Valencia, La Marina de València has a cultural heritage that includes historical buildings (Varadero, modernist sheds, the Clock Building, among others) and avant-garde constructions. The Veles e Vents building stands out, one of the main gastronomic and cultural complexes in the city, awarded the LEAF Award for architecture. The dock is home to a business incubator that, under the Marina de Empresas brand, has placed the site as an example of a district in innovation, training and entertainment. The Valencian marina has been configured as an excellent option both as a base for boats and for temporary stays with competitive prices, starting at 6.75 euros per day and discounts of up to 40% for annual stays. It has more than 800 moorings from 7 to 150 meters and an average draft of 7.5 meters. Headquarters of nautical competitions of international scope, such as Valencia Boat Show, La Marina de València hosts high competition regattas throughout the year. It has two mooring areas: the Outer Marinas (North and South) and the inner dock that houses the renowned Superyacht T-dock jetty. The Outer Marinas (North and South) offer more than 700 moorings for lengths from 7 to 150 meters. Another prominent area of the port is the terminal known as the T-Dock Superyacht Marina, specially designed to house up to 42 superyachts in moorings from 25 to 80 meters in length, with the possibility of accommodating larger vessels. Located a few minutes from the center of Valencia, it is directly connected to the Manises International Airport. From La Marina de València you can access all kinds of services (taxis, buses, trains, rent-a-car companies, shops, cinemas, theaters) and other points of interest to get around and see the city. It has a commercial and social area with a wide range of restaurants, entertainment venues and nautical services designed so that the stay reaches high quality parameters.

We were 3 months in the winter from October to end of 2020. Valencia its wonderfull, take your bike and go visit the city, the historical part its amazing, you have a lot to see and the best way to do it, its using a bike (the marina its not near). Friendly staf, good conditions, wc its not so good. Theres one marineer realy helpfull, friendly and realy woried about you, is name is Charly, and its an exemple... Try to go to the sud side of the marina, if the wind picks up from N/Ne the marina its very bad, we were from 2 Times with strong tormenta 40knots wind and the boats were likes horses, a lot of damage on other boats, it was almost impossible to stay a board, if comes bad weather ask to change to Sud side of the marina. The staf were very helpefull. I wil go there again but for the Sud marina side.
